Project Description: The City of Lubbock recently experienced a rupture in one of the two double membrane gas containment systems covering the sludge holding tanks at the Southeast Water Reclamation Plant (SEWRP). The rupture separated the outer membrane from the tank wall anchors, but left the inner membrane intact, so all biogas containment is still secure. The City is seeking an expert vendor to provide a replacement for both the inner and outer membranes, as well as the onsite installation of the membranes.
